Welcome to the Murmura plugin program! Murmura powers the audio-guide app for the Vellwick Gallery network, and your plugin can add tours, ambient tracks, or quiz stops. Start by cloning the starter kit and running the sandbox — it mimics a gallery floor with fake exhibits. All calls to the tour-composer service need authentication, even in sandbox mode. Don't share credentials between teammates; request your own instead. For initial testing, use the sandbox key below.

gateway credential: kto23_LX9A4ys6i4nzHtpOLNLodKK

## Deployment

The Corvid uploader pushes finished batches to the Mersey partner SFTP drop after each release build. Deploy via the standard pipeline; no manual steps. Failed transfers retry twice, then alert on-call. Rotate the drop credentials quarterly per partner agreement. The uploader's current connection settings are listed below.

deployment values, yadug-bawif:
[framir]
team = pelox
access_code = ac_a38ab2
owner = tamion.julael
host = framir.tolvaqlabs.test
port = 11211
peer = tammir.zemvargrid.local
salt = 2215ef03
pin = 1541

**Vendor note: Inkmill markdown pipeline**

Rendering for Parchway docs is outsourced to Inkmill under an annual contract, renewing each March. They handle sanitization and PDF export; we own the upload queue. SLA: 4-hour response on rendering failures. Escalate only after two failed retries. Their support desk is reachable at the address below.

billing contact of hahaf-baguf = zorael.tammir.jorius@sivrelhq.internal